Happiness
One must believe in the possibility of happiness in order to be happy, and I now believe in it. Let the dead bury the dead, but while I'm alive, I must live and be happy.
- Leo Tolstoy
The secret of happiness is not in doing what one likes, but in liking what one does.
- J. M. Barrie
If you search the world for happiness, you may find it in the end, for the world is round and will lead you back to your door.
- Robert Brault
Doing good to others is not a duty. It is a joy, for it increases your own health and happiness.
- Zaroaster
What can be added to the happiness of the man who is in health, who is out of debt and has a clear conscience?
- Adam Smith
Happiness and moral duty are inseparably connected.
- George Washington
Annual income twenty pounds, annual expenditure nineteen and six, result happiness. Annual income twenty pounds, annual expenditure twenty pounds and six, result misery.
- Charles Dickens
Then he thought himself unhappy, but happiness was all in the future; now he felt that the best happiness was already in the past.
- Leo Tolstoy
What is the definition of happiness? The feeling that arises when you are acting
according to your nature, is called "Happiness".
- Deep Trivedi
Happiness is spiritual, born of truth and love. It is unselfish; therefore it cannot exist alone, but requires all mankind to share it.
- Mary Baker Eddy
